npm 包 gulp-file-2 使用教程

阅读时长 2 分钟读完

介绍

gulp-file-2 是一个基于 gulp 的插件,用来创建文件并将其写入到指定目录中。它与 gulp 和其他gulp插件协作,提供了一种优雅的方式来构建前端应用程序。

在本文中,我们将深入讨论 gulp-file-2 的用法,并提供详细的指导,帮助新手快速上手使用。

安装

gulp-file-2 可以通过 npm 安装:

用法

为了使用 gulp-file-2,你需要先加载它,并将其传递给 gulp.src 函数。然后用 .pipe() 方法将它与其他 gulp 插件连接起来。

以下是一个简单的示例,演示如何使用 gulp-file-2 创建一个新文件,将其写入到指定目录并同时将其压缩:

-- -------------------- ---- -------
--- ---- - ----------------
--- ---- - ---------------------
--- ---- - -----------------------

-------------------- -----------
  ------ -------------- ------------------- -----------
    -------------
    ---------------------------
---

在以上示例中,gulp-file-2首先被引入进来,并生成一个名为 “app.js” 的文件,文件内容为 “console.log("Hello World!");”。两个gulp插件 gzip 和 gulp.dest 都被传递进来,用来压缩和将文件写入到指定目录。

API

file(filename, content[, options])

创建一个 gulp-file-2 文件对象。

参数:

  • filename {String} - 文件名。
  • content {String|Buffer|Function} - 文件内容。如果是函数,则返回一个 Promise。
  • options {Object} - 选项对象。具体选项请参阅 vinyl

file.readable()

生成一个可读流的转换器。

file.writable()

生成一个可写流的转换器。

总结

通过本文的学习,我们可以看到,gulp-file-2 的使用非常简单,但它却是一款非常实用的前端构建工具。希望本文能够为大家提供详细的指导,并帮助大家更好地使用gulp-file-2进行前端项目的构建。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055b8381e8991b448d9175

纠错
反馈